What does a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operator do?

A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operator is responsible for managing the official game clock during basketball games on a short-term or as-needed basis. Their main duties include starting and stopping the clock according to the referee’s signals, ensuring the game time is kept accurately, and sometimes operating the shot clock as well. They work closely with referees, scorekeepers, and other event staff to ensure the smooth timing and flow of the game. This role requires attention to detail, quick reactions, and a clear understanding of basketball rules regarding timing. Temporary operators are often hired for specific events, tournaments, or seasonal needs.

What are some common challenges faced by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operators and how can they be managed?

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operators often face challenges such as maintaining focus during fast-paced games, quickly adapting to sudden rule infractions, and accurately following referee signals. Since the pace can be intense, especially during critical game moments, it's important to stay attentive and communicate clearly with referees and the scoreboard team. Familiarizing yourself with league-specific timing rules and practicing with the equipment beforehand can help ensure smooth operation and reduce errors during live games.

What is the difference between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operator vs Basketball Scorekeeper?

The Temporary Basketball Game Clock Operator primarily manages the game clock during matches, ensuring accurate timing. The Basketball Scorekeeper records points, fouls, and game stats. While both roles are essential for game management and often work together, their responsibilities differ: one focuses on timing, the other on scoring. Both positions typically require similar certifications and are employed in similar settings like schools and sports leagues.

Position OverviewOpen Gym Premier is looking for reliable and detail-oriented Stat Keepers and Scorekeepers to support upcoming Adidas basketball event in Bryan, Texas. This is a seasonal, event-based position for select tournament dates.
Stat Keepers and Scorekeepers support game operations by managing the scoreboard, game clock, and in-game stats using our in-house platform The Passport. Working courtside during tournaments, you'll help ensure each game runs smoothly and accurately. This role is ideal for individuals who are reliable, detail-oriented, and comfortable in a fast-paced basketball environment.
Schedule
This is a seasonal/event-based position for select Adidas basketball events in Bryan, TX. Applicants must be available for the following event date:
  • adidas 3SSB Boys Session 3 (Live) : July 8-12, 2026

Stat Keeper Responsibilities:
  • Perform a roster compliance check to ensure players on the court match the roster displayed in The Passport.
  • Keep full game statistics using The Passport Stats Platform, including: Points, Rebounds, Assists, Steals, Blocks, Turnovers, Fouls.
  • Manage live stat entry with accuracy and attention to detail.
  • Report any court, roster, or gameplay issues to the Event Leads immediately.
  • Finalize and submit all game results through The Passport platform.
  • Verify that scores and stats are accurate before submission.

Score Keeper Responsibilities:
  • Prepare a new scoresheet for the upcoming game.
  • Set up and prepare the game clock for proper timing.
  • Operate the score console to manage the game clock and scoreboard.
  • Maintain the scoresheet, including running score, team/player fouls, and possession.
  • Verbally communicate game events to the Stat Keeper to ensure accurate stat entry.
  • Notify the Event Lead immediately about any court or equipment issues.
